Overzealous Yankees Fan Spawns Memes After Viral Ball-Stealing Moment
Last night's World Series game between the New York Yankees and the Los Angeles Dodgers featured a confrontational moment involving Dodgers star Mookie Betts—though not with another player. An excited Yankees fan, with the help of his friend next to him, tried to pry a ball out of Betts' mitt in the outfield. Naturally, social media had a field day making light of the moment.
It all happened in the bottom of the first inning. Betts caught the ball against the outfield wall and a Yankees fan in the front row reached over into the player's mitt to try and pull it out for himself. When Betts tried to fight back, another fan grabbed the player's arm to let his friend grab a hold of the ball. Eventually, it flew back onto the field, resulting in an out due to fan interference and a scuffle that was for naught.

The two fans, one of whom is a Yankees season ticket holder, were promptly ejected from the game and banned from the next game. Comedian and former The Daily Show fixture Roy Wood Jr. said it was "Wild to pay top dollar to sit this close then do some s--t like this to get yourself tossed."

According to USA Today, the Yankees are barring season ticket holder Austin Capobianco and his friend John Peter from attending Game 5.
"The Yankees and Major League Baseball maintain a zero-tolerance policy toward the type of behavior displayed last night," the Yankees said in a statement, calling it "egregious and unacceptable" conduct. "These fans will not be permitted to attend tonight’s game in any capacity.”
In the end, the Yankees came out victorious and shut out the Dodgers from sweeping the Series. Game 5 kicks off today at 8:08 p.m. ET.
